Position Description:

The Research Administrative Assistant for the College of Education, Health, and Human Sciences (CEHHS) in the Office of Community Engagement and Partnerships (OCEP), Cherokee Mills site will provide administrative support to the Cherokee Mills Program Coordinator in a community-based setting. The purpose of this position is to provide support for critical community engagement projects in the College of Education, Health, and Human Sciences (CEHHS) and in the College of Social Work (CSW). The individual in this position will be responsible for a variety of administrative tasks to ensure the smooth operation of collaborative programs at the off-campus Cherokee Mills site.

Responsibilities:

* Provide administrative support to the Program Coordinator, including managing calendars, scheduling appointments and meetings, making copies and packets of forms and handouts, scanning documents, and a variety of other office tasks and duties as assigned by the Program Coordinator.
* Draft and edit correspondence, reports, and other documents as needed.
* Assist with communications with community partners and participants (e.g., emails, creating and mailing documents, paperwork, and newsletters).
* Assist with event planning (e.g., recruitment events, training programs, and information fairs).
* Perform basic research tasks, including recruiting study participants, screening, interviewing, obtaining informed consent, searching for published literature, compiling annotated bibliographies, inputting data, and maintaining databases.
* Translate project documents (e.g., interview transcripts and recruitment posters) from English to Spanish and provide spoken translation services for clients in a variety of settings (e.g., office, workshops, recruitment events).

Required Qualifications:

* Ability to speak, read, and write Spanish fluently (Spanish-English bilingual).
* Excellent organizational and time management skills, with the ability to manage multiple tasks and priorities.
* Strong written and verbal communication skills in English and Spanish.
* Microsoft Office Suite and other relevant software and technology skills.
* High School diploma or GED

Preferred Qualifications:

* Ability to work independently and collaboratively as part of a team.
